Enphase Energy recently announced an increase in the deployment of solutions for legacy NEM solar systems and launched the IQ Battery 5P, yet its stock price fell by 7% over the last month. The decline comes despite Enphase's initiative to support homeowners with energy demands in California and its expansion of grid services programs. The company's latest earnings report showed a drop in sales and net income compared to the previous year, which might have impacted investor sentiment. Additionally, the broader market exhibited volatility, with major indexes experiencing fluctuations due to tariff concerns and mixed economic data, potentially influencing Enphase's stock performance. While Enphase's efforts to innovate and expand its offerings continue, market uncertainty and economic conditions appeared to shape its recent stock trajectory. A -7% return for Enphase stands out against the broader market's 3% decline, highlighting specific challenges the company might face.
See the full analysis report here for a deeper understanding of Enphase Energy.
Enphase Energy delivered a total return of 26.91% over the last five years, underscoring its ability to weather various market challenges. During this period, the company made significant strides in expanding its international presence by entering markets like Vietnam and Malaysia with its IQ8P Microinverters and launching the powerful IQ Battery 5P across Germany, Austria, and Switzerland. Additionally, the integration with Octopus Energy's smart tariffs in the UK reflected Enphase's focus on enhancing consumer energy efficiency.
The company also undertook a substantial share repurchase initiative, acquiring shares worth approximately US$601.38 million as part of its buyback plan. However, the financial results released in early February 2025 highlighted a challenging fiscal environment, with a reported decrease in both sales and net income for the year 2024. Despite expanding its business operations and product offerings, these financial headwinds may have impacted the stock’s performance compared to the broader market and industry over the past year.
This article by Simply Wall St is general in nature. We provide commentary based on historical data and analyst forecasts only using an unbiased methodology and our articles are not intended to be financial advice. It does not constitute a recommendation to buy or sell any stock, and does not take account of your objectives, or your financial situation. We aim to bring you long-term focused analysis driven by fundamental data. Note that our analysis may not factor in the latest price-sensitive company announcements or qualitative material. Simply Wall St has no position in any stocks mentioned.
Companies discussed in this article include NasdaqGM:ENPH.
Have feedback on this article? Concerned about the content? Get in touch with us directly. Alternatively, email editorial-team@simplywallst.com
免責聲明:投資有風險,本文並非投資建議,以上內容不應被視為任何金融產品的購買或出售要約、建議或邀請,作者或其他用戶的任何相關討論、評論或帖子也不應被視為此類內容。本文僅供一般參考,不考慮您的個人投資目標、財務狀況或需求。TTM對信息的準確性和完整性不承擔任何責任或保證,投資者應自行研究並在投資前尋求專業建議。